Tuning issues after dealership visit

Bought a used Mustang with unknown mods – dealership won’t tune it – help understanding what I need to do now. Ford dealership completed 4k of work to my transmission. When I picked it up, it ran like garbage. After taking it back to them I was told they set it back to factory settings and I need to have another company complete the modified tuner work
 
This is true.
If any of the electronics, or solenoids controlled by the electronics of the transmission got replaced, they need to be programmed to the PCM.
That automatically puts it back to a "stock" tune.
The Dealer would have no idea who "tuned" your PCM previously and even if they did, they could not duplicate it.
You are going to have to get it re-tuned for whatever mods were done to the car.
